Programme Manager

About the role

We’re recruiting a Programme Manager to join a Housing company. The role sits within the PMO and will report into the Information Governance and PMO Senior Manager.

Salary: £39,571 - £42,614

The role offers a hybrid working pattern of 37.5hrs between Monday and Friday, with an office based in Newcastle.

Role Description:

The role requires effective co-ordination of the programme’s projects and management of their interdependencies including oversight of any risks and issues arising. It also includes the co-ordination of the new capability for the business to enable effective change and realisation of projected benefits.

As a Programme Manager you will be responsible for:

  • Planning, developing and proactively monitoring the Programme against agreed milestones.

  • Defining and deploying effective governance arrangements to manage risk and ensure the timely resolution of issues, escalating appropriately.

  • Ensuring adequate requirements capture and solution design documentation is in place to provide assurances in relation to the overall integrity of the Programme.

  • Managing the Programme's budget on behalf of the Sponsor, monitoring expenditure and costs against delivered and realised benefits as the Programme progresses.

  • Ensuring mechanisms are in place to measure the success of the Programme, including ROI.

  • Resource planning and allocation of common resources and skills within the Programme's individual projects

  • Adopting an Agile approach to reviewing and where necessary adjusting Programmes, ensuring they remain aligned, fit for purpose and are adaptable to influencing factors (internal and external).

  • Design, development and delivery of key communications to all stakeholders including the Programme change management strategy.

  • Engage with stakeholder and support and influence them to optimise the impact they have on outcomes.

  • Working with the IT Service Delivery Manager, Project Managers, Application & Integration Architect and other invested stakeholders to ensure smooth and comprehensive handover to BAU Support.

  • Reporting the progress of the programme at regular intervals to the Sponsor and the PMO and Information Governance Senior Manager in preparation for YHN’s Sponsorship Board.

  • Setting standards for documentation and expectations around programme and project delivery with the team and ensuring controls are maintained through the life of the project to a high standard and Supporting the organisation to develop a more innovative and collaborative culture, demonstrating values and behaviours in all we do.
